Who we are:

Envision Cold is a leading provider of cold storage solutions serving temperature-controlled supply chains across North America. We support customers in food, beverage, and other temperature-sensitive industries with end-to-end cold chain capabilities, from initial processing through final-mile delivery. Headquartered in Atlanta, GA, we continue to expand through development, construction, and acquisition of best-in-class cold storage facilities.

What we’re looking for:

We are seeking an experienced Enterprise Maintenance, Systems & Reliability Manager to own the systems, data, and reliability engineering programs that underpin maintenance operations across every Envision Cold facility. This corporate role partners with the VP of Facilities/Refrigeration Maintenance & Reliability Operations and both regional Directors of Maintenance and Reliability to select, implement, and build out the CMMS platform, standards, metrics, and reliability programs that Directors and Regional Maintenance Managers use to run their coasts — without owning day-to-day site or regional headcount.

This role is ideal for a maintenance or reliability professional who thinks in systems and data as much as in wrenches and refrigerant — someone who can translate field-level realities into enterprise standards, technology, and reliability strategy, and who is comfortable driving change across the organization through influence and subject-matter expertise rather than direct authority.

This is a hybrid position. Ideal candidates will be based in the Atlanta area to collaborate with our Corporate team in the office when not traveling, with in-office frequency ranging from 1 to 3 days per week depending on business needs. Candidates outside the Atlanta area must live within a reasonable distance of a major airport to allow for travel, including recurring trips to our Corporate office. This role will require regular travel regardless of location.

What you’ll do (including, but not limited to):

Enterprise Reliability & Maintenance Strategy

  • Design and own the enterprise-wide reliability strategy — criticality-based PM/PdM optimization, reliability-centered maintenance (RCM) principles, and failure mode analysis — applied consistently across every Envision Cold facility.
  • Partner with the VP and both Directors of Maintenance and Reliability to translate strategy into standardized programs, templates, and playbooks that Regional Managers execute at the site level.
  • Analyze enterprise-wide maintenance, downtime, and reliability data to identify systemic issues, cross-regional trends, and improvement opportunities.
  • Benchmark performance across regions and facilities, and recommend where standards, training, or investment should be prioritized.

CMMS & Maintenance Systems

  • Lead selection and implementation of the enterprise CMMS/EAM platform — including vendor selection within the first 30 days of hire — then own its ongoing administration, configuration, and continuous improvement, including asset hierarchies, PM schedules, and work-order standards used company-wide.
  • Ensure data integrity and consistency of maintenance records, equipment history, and reliability metrics across all facilities and regions.
  • Build and maintain enterprise dashboards and KPI reporting (uptime, MTBF/MTTR, PM compliance, maintenance cost per unit, and similar) for the VP, Directors, and executive leadership.
  • Evaluate and implement new maintenance technology (e.g., predictive maintenance sensors, condition monitoring, mobile CMMS tools) and lead enterprise-wide rollouts.
  • Feed CMMS-based vendor performance data into the scorecards Regional Managers use to manage the single-source facilities vendor relationship.

Refrigeration, PSM & Compliance Systems

  • Own the enterprise systems and documentation infrastructure used to track PSM/RMP compliance (PHAs, MOC, PSSR, mechanical integrity) for ammonia refrigeration systems company-wide — the underlying data and systems, not the PSM program itself, which the Manager, Maintenance, Refrigeration and Corporate PSM owns as the organization’s subject-matter authority on PSM/RMP compliance.
  • Serve as an enterprise subject-matter expert on refrigeration systems, equipment, and reliability engineering — distinct from PSM/RMP program authority — providing technical consultation to Regional Managers and Directors on complex or recurring system issues.
  • Maintain enterprise-wide certification and training compliance tracking (RETA, EPA 608, OSHA 10/30, HAZWOPER, and similar) across all maintenance personnel.
  • Support audit readiness and continuous improvement of compliance systems ahead of internal and regulatory reviews.

Capital & Cross-Functional Partnership

  • Provide data-driven input into enterprise capital planning, helping prioritize reliability- and risk-based capital investment across regions.
  • Partner with the Directors, Regional Managers, Engineering, and Operations to evaluate the reliability and maintainability impact of new equipment, facility designs, and acquisitions.
  • Support acquisition due diligence from a systems, reliability, and maintenance-data perspective.

Talent & Continuous Improvement

  • Build out enterprise training curricula and certification pathways (e.g., RETA, GCCA, Lanier Tech) in partnership with the Directors, and track completion company-wide.
  • Lead or mentor a small enterprise team (e.g., reliability engineers, CMMS analysts) as headcount is added.
  • Champion Lean/Six Sigma and continuous improvement methodology across the maintenance organization.
  • Perform other duties as assigned/needed.
Requirements:

What you’ll bring to the role: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Reliability Engineering, Facilities/Maintenance Management, or a related field preferred; CMRP or CRE certification strongly preferred; equivalent experience considered.
  • 8+ years of progressive maintenance/reliability experience in industrial, warehouse, manufacturing, or cold storage environments, including significant experience leading selection and implementation of a CMMS/EAM platform, plus ongoing administration, at an enterprise or multi-site level.
  • Direct experience with ammonia and/or Freon-based refrigeration systems and OSHA PSM/EPA RMP compliance strongly preferred.
  • RETA CARO, CIRO, EPA Section 608 Universal Certification, and/or OSHA 10/30 certification a plus.
  • Strong data analysis skills, with the ability to build KPI dashboards and translate data into actionable recommendations for executive audiences.
  • Working knowledge of reliability engineering principles (RCM, FMEA, predictive maintenance technologies).
  • Experience developing enterprise-wide standards, SOPs, or training programs across multiple sites or regions.
  • Excellent communication and cross-functional collaboration skills; comfortable influencing and driving change without direct authority over field leadership.
  • Advanced proficiency with Microsoft Excel, CMMS/EAM platforms, and reporting/BI tools.
  • Ability to travel 15–25% of the time to facilities across the country to support system rollouts, training, and audits; expect travel well above that average during the initial CMMS rollout, when all sites are targeted to go live within the first 90 days.
  • Physically able to enter and work within cold storage/freezer environments during site visits as needed.
